Hot Honey Pickled Carrots

Description

Crunchy and vibrant, these Hot Honey Pickled Carrots offer a delightful blend of sweet, spicy, and tangy flavors, perfect as a side dish or topping.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ups carrots, sliced
  • 1 cup water
  • 1 cup apple cider vinegar
  • 1/2 cup honey
  • 1 teaspoon red pepper flakes
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 clove garlic, crushed
  • 1 teaspoon black peppercorns

Instructions

  1. Combine water, apple cider vinegar, honey, salt, red pepper flakes, crushed garlic, and black peppercorns in a saucepan.
  2. Heat the mixture until it reaches a gentle boil, stirring occasionally.
  3. Slice your carrots into thin, even disks or sticks.
  4. Transfer the sliced carrots into a clean jar, packing them snugly.
  5. Pour the hot pickling liquid over the carrots, ensuring they are submerged.
  6. Secure the lid tightly and allow the jar to cool at room temperature.
  7. Refrigerate once cooled and let them sit for at least 24 hours before enjoying.

Notes

For best flavor, prepare these a few days in advance. They will last up to 2 weeks in the refrigerator.
